I founded Acheron Press in 2008 after one big publishing house insisted upon changing the title of The Meaning of Madness to just Madness.

The name ‘Acheron’ was inspired by a verse from Vergil’s Æneid,

Flectere si nequeo superos, Acheronta movebo.

The line is often translated as, ‘If I cannot bend Heaven, I shall move Hell,’ and was chosen by Freud as the epigraph to his Interpretation of Dreams.

According to the psychoanalyst Bruno Bettelheim, the line encapsulates Freud’s theory that people who have no control over the outside world turn inward to the underworld of their own minds.
